WebGreatest Kings of Georgia George I of Georgia Giorgi I of the House of Bagrationi, was the king of Georgia from 1014 until his death in 1027. He spent most of his thirteen-year-long reign waging a bloody and fruitless territorial war with the Byzantine Empire. Early reign
